POLICE MAKE ARREST.

MISSING THEATRE TAKINGS. INCIDENT IN HOTEL. THEFT CHARGE PREFERRED. [By Telegraph. —Press Association]. WELLINGTON, Sept. 22. Detectives arrested a man in Palmerston North this week on a charge of theft of theatre takings of tho Paramount and Roxy Theatres, Wellington. A bag containing cash and cheques, totalling about £2OO, takings from these theatres, was last week missed from a hotel office, where it had been deposited. It is believed that all the cheques and a large part of the cash has been recovered.
